生物化学编程是什么专业学的
-
生物化学编程是一门综合了生物化学和计算机科学的学科,主要研究利用计算机技术和算法来分析、模拟和设计生物化学系统的方法和工具。它将生物化学的基本原理和计算机科学的方法相结合,旨在解决生物化学领域的问题和挑战。
生物化学编程的学习内容主要包括以下几个方面:
-
生物化学基础知识:学习生物化学的基本概念、原理和方法,包括生物分子的结构与功能、代谢途径、蛋白质结构与功能等。这些基础知识对于理解生物化学系统的运作原理至关重要。
-
计算机科学基础知识:学习计算机科学的基本概念和技术,包括编程语言、数据结构、算法设计与分析等。这些基础知识为开发生物化学编程工具和模型提供了技术支持。
-
生物信息学:学习利用计算机技术和算法来处理、分析和解释生物学数据的方法和工具。这包括基因组学、蛋白质组学、转录组学等生物信息学领域的知识和技术。
-
生物化学模拟与建模:学习利用计算机模拟和建模方法来研究生物化学系统的行为和性质。通过建立数学模型和模拟实验,可以帮助理解生物化学反应的动力学过程、预测生物分子的结构与功能等。
-
生物化学编程工具与软件开发:学习开发和使用生物化学编程工具和软件,用于处理生物化学数据、分析生物化学系统和设计新的生物分子。
生物化学编程的应用领域非常广泛,包括药物设计与发现、蛋白质工程、基因组学研究、生物能源开发等。通过将计算机科学和生物化学相结合,生物化学编程可以提供更高效、准确和可预测的方法来解决生物化学领域的问题,推动生物技术的发展和应用。
1年前 -
-
生物化学编程是一门跨学科的专业,结合了生物化学和计算机科学的知识。该专业旨在培养具备生物化学和计算机科学背景的人才,能够在生物领域中应用计算机编程和数据分析技术解决问题。
以下是生物化学编程专业学习的主要内容:
-
生物化学基础知识:学生将学习生物化学的基本概念、生物分子结构和功能、生物代谢途径等。了解生物化学的基础知识对于理解生物领域的问题和应用计算机编程技术解决问题至关重要。
-
计算机编程:学生将学习计算机编程的基本原理和技术,包括常见的编程语言(如Python、R、Java等)、算法和数据结构、软件开发方法等。掌握计算机编程技术能够帮助学生开发生物领域的软件工具和分析平台。
-
数据分析和统计学:学生将学习数据分析和统计学的基本原理和方法,包括数据清洗、数据可视化、统计推断、机器学习等。通过数据分析和统计学技术,学生可以从生物实验数据中提取有用的信息并进行解释和预测。
-
生物信息学:学生将学习生物信息学的理论和实践,包括基因组学、转录组学、蛋白质组学等。生物信息学是生物化学编程的重要组成部分,通过生物信息学技术,学生可以处理和分析大规模的生物数据,如基因序列、基因表达数据等。
-
生物化学编程应用:学生将学习如何将计算机编程和数据分析技术应用于生物化学领域的具体问题,如药物设计、基因工程、生物分子模拟等。通过实际案例的学习,学生可以将所学知识应用于解决实际的生物化学问题。
生物化学编程专业的毕业生可以在生物技术公司、医药公司、研究机构等领域工作,从事生物数据分析、药物研发、基因工程等相关工作。此外,他们还可以选择继续深造,攻读生物化学、计算机科学等相关的研究生学位。
1年前 -
-
生物化学编程是一门涉及生物化学和计算机科学的交叉学科,旨在利用计算机编程技术解决生物化学领域的问题。生物化学编程的目标是将计算机科学的方法和工具应用于生物化学研究,以推动生物化学的发展和创新。
生物化学编程的专业学习内容主要包括以下几个方面:
-
生物化学基础知识:学习生物化学的基本理论和知识,包括生物分子结构、代谢途径、酶反应、蛋白质结构和功能等。这些知识为后续的计算机编程应用奠定基础。
-
计算机科学基础知识:学习计算机科学的基本理论和知识,包括编程语言、数据结构、算法设计与分析、数据库管理等。这些知识为生物化学问题的建模和求解提供技术支持。
-
生物信息学:学习生物信息学的基本理论和方法,包括序列比对、基因组学、转录组学、蛋白质结构预测等。生物信息学是生物化学编程中非常重要的一部分,通过分析生物数据和模拟生物过程,可以揭示生物化学现象的本质。
-
数据分析与可视化:学习如何处理和分析生物化学数据,并利用可视化工具展示结果。数据分析和可视化是生物化学编程中的重要环节,可以帮助研究人员更好地理解和解释实验结果。
-
生物化学模拟与建模:学习如何使用计算机模拟生物化学过程,并构建相应的数学模型。生物化学模拟与建模可以帮助研究人员预测和优化生物反应,提高实验效率和经济性。
-
生物化学数据库与软件开发:学习如何设计和开发生物化学数据库和软件工具。生物化学数据库和软件工具的开发可以帮助研究人员管理和共享生物化学数据,提高研究效率。
在学习生物化学编程专业的过程中,学生需要掌握生物化学和计算机科学的基本理论和方法,同时还需要具备较强的实验操作能力和数据分析能力。此外,还需要具备良好的逻辑思维能力和问题解决能力,以便能够将计算机编程技术应用于生物化学领域的实际问题中。
1年前 -